Search Engine Optimization (SEO) is the practice of improving a website’s visibility in search engine results pages in order to increase organic (non-paid) traffic. It involves both technical and content-related strategies aimed at ensuring a site is understandable and relevant to search engines like Google, Bing, and others.

Types of SEO

On-Page SEO

Focuses on optimizing elements directly within a website:

  • Keyword usage: Matching content with terms users search for.
  • Title tags & meta descriptions: Inform search engines and users about page content.
  • Headings (H1–H6): Provide structure and context.
  • Internal linking: Helps with navigation and distributes page authority.
  • Content quality: Relevance, readability, freshness, and depth.
  • Image optimization: Alt text, file names, compression.

Off-Page SEO

Involves activities outside the website to improve authority and reputation:

  • Backlinks: Links from other reputable websites.
  • Social signals: Mentions and shares on social media (indirect impact).
  • Brand mentions: Recognition across the web.
  • Guest blogging, influencer outreach, PR.

Technical SEO

Ensures that a site meets the technical requirements of modern search engines:

  • Site speed
  • Mobile-friendliness
  • Crawlability and indexing
  • Sitemap.xml and robots.txt
  • Canonical tags
  • Structured data (schema.org)
  • HTTPS/SSL
